DHT11 온습도 센서 쉴드 -Wemos D1 미니용
(DHT Shield for WeMos D1 mini)
개요
- 본 제품은 Wemos D1 Mini 용 DHT11 온습도 센서 쉴드입니다.
- D1 Mini에 본 쉴드를 꼽아 사용이 가능합니다.
- 알림: 온습도는 센서가 마지막에 읽은 데이터를 리포트합니다. 실시간 데이터를 얻기 위해서는 두번 읽어야 하며, 센서를 반복해서 읽는 시간 간격은 최소 2초이상을 주어야 합니다.
특징
- Temperature: 0~60°C (±2°C)
- Humidity: 20-90%RH (±5%RH)
-
Pins:
PinsD1 mini Shield D4 Data out
문서
-
Arduino Code
- Install DHT sensor library
- Test Code
NodeMCU Code
- Example
-
pin = 4
status, temp, humi, temp_dec, humi_dec = dht.read(pin)
if status == dht.OK then
-- Integer firmware using this example
print(string.format("DHT Temperature:%d.%03d;Humidity:%d.%03d\r\n",
math.floor(temp),
temp_dec,
math.floor(humi),
humi_dec
))
-- Float firmware using this example
print("DHT Temperature:"..temp..";".."Humidity:"..humi)
elseif status == dht.ERROR_CHECKSUM then
print( "DHT Checksum error." )
elseif status == dht.ERROR_TIMEOUT then
print( "DHT timed out." )
end